C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2015 in Review

1,242 of the 3,582 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Citigroup (C) for Q3 2015, worth a combined $109B — down 10% from $121B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 97 funds closed out of C and 90 opened new positions — a net loss of 7 holders — while 461 trimmed existing stakes and 511 added.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$614M. The largest seller was Westfield Capital Management, cutting an estimated $243M.
